The orchards

The orchard is an integral part of our rural landscape. It is the link between agricultural areas and gardens and underwent profound changes these last decades. At the end of the 19th century there were still more than 1100 apple and pear varieties available, but for the moment our choice is limited to about thirty. This unique heritage is nevertheless blossoming thanks to the creation of a Walloon network of protective orchards that aim to reintroduce the old varieties.
